OpenAI shuts down Sora AI video app as Disney exits $1B partnership

Summary

OpenAI has shut down the Sora AI video app due to legal pressures and the collapse of a $1 billion partnership with Disney. Sora struggled to gain traction and failed to replicate the success of similar platforms like TikTok and Vine.

Key Takeaways

  • OpenAI has shut down its Sora AI video app due to mounting legal pressure and the collapse of a $1 billion partnership with Disney.
  • The partnership with Disney aimed to incorporate licensed characters into AI-generated videos but has been abandoned.
  • Sora struggled to gain traction and faced criticism over its AI training practices, particularly regarding copyright issues.
  • OpenAI plans to integrate video generation capabilities from Sora into its broader products, like ChatGPT, rather than exiting the AI video space entirely.
